Responsibilities
- Continuous promotion of, and adherence to, the discipline specific procedures and providing feedback for continuous improvement
- Support the development and delivery of the technical assurance framework
- Monitor compliance with competence standards
- Participate in incident investigations as required
- Set performance expectations for direct reports
- Actively maintain own competence and continuous development
- Provide discipline support to the business
- Ensure learning opportunities are captured and realized
- Knowledge of relevant regulatory framework and legislation
- Oversee Piping Engineering work being carried out by EPC contractors for major greenfield and brownfield projects as part of the Clients PMT
- Promote effective communication and challenge within the EPC Contractors Engineering team in order to foster the production of safe, cost-effective, fit for purpose, and constructible Piping designs
- Attend daily/weekly engineering progress meetings and generate status reports as required
- Provide resolution for technical Piping engineering problems, coordinate application of solutions
- Ensure that all work is completed without compromise to quality and is delivered according to the project schedule
- Excellent knowledge of the fundamental requirements of the piping discipline, and the basic requirements of other disciplines
- Excellent knowledge of applicable local and international standards and statutory and regulatory requirements

Expected:
- Bachelor’s degree in mechanical engineering or equivalent from an accredited university with a minimum of fifteen (15+) years of relevant experience in the Offshore/Onshore Oil & Gas industry, including a minimum of five (5) years (preferred) in the GCC region
- Must have at least five (5) years of experience in a similar position in mega Oil & Gas or Petrochemical projects, managing a team of Specialists, Senior Engineers, and Engineers
- Offshore EPC experience is a must, while ADNOC experience is desired
- Experience of working in a multi-project/multi-disciplined environment and throughout all engineering and design phases of projects
- Previous experience of working in the Middle East would be an advantage
